| Core Wire * Cross-sectional Area (mm²) | Rated Voltage (kV) | Insulation Thickness (mm) | Sheath Thickness (mm) | Approximate Outer Diameter (mm) | Conductor Material |
|---|---|---|---|---|---|
| 3*50 | 3.6/6 | 1.4 | 2.0 | 28.6 | Oxygen-Free Copper |
| 3*70 | 3.6/6 | 1.6 | 2.2 | 32.1 | Oxygen-Free Copper |
| 3*95 | 8.7/10 | 1.8 | 2.4 | 36.8 | Oxygen-Free Copper |
| 3*120 | 8.7/10 | 2.0 | 2.6 | 40.5 | Oxygen-Free Copper |
| 3*185 | 12/20 | 2.4 | 2.8 | 48.2 | Oxygen-Free Copper |
| 3*240 | 12/20 | 2.6 | 3.0 | 53.7 | Oxygen-Free Copper |

Question 1: What is the operating temperature range of this VV cable?
Answer 1: The maximum long-term permissible operating temperature of the conductor is 70℃, the laying temperature should not be lower than 0℃, and the maximum conductor temperature during a short circuit (duration not exceeding 5 seconds) should not exceed 160℃.

Q6: Does the cable have flame-retardant properties?
A6: Standard VV cables have basic flame-retardant properties. If you have higher flame retardant requirements, we can provide ZR-VV flame retardant cables that meet the IEC 332-3 standard.
